Run tables are designed by Sam Hecht and Kim Colin, designers of the simple and no-nonsense. Made of responsibly selected, sustainable wood and recycled aluminum and engineered to last, Run is right for a multitude of uses at home, for hospitality and in the workplace. Versions with anodized aluminum and accoya wood are suitable for outdoor use. Made in the USA.

Sam Hecht & Kim Colin

Sam Hecht & Kim Colin

Designers Sem Hecht and Kim Colin are founders of the London-based Industrial Facility, formed in 2002 to explore the junction between industrial design and everyday life. Hecht and Colin have worked in various fields including product and furniture design, transportation and clothing. Their mission is to create beauty, functionality and quality, that will stand the test of time and exceed expectations.
